@@ -39,7 +39,6 @@ if [ $LIBS_HAS_ASSET == "0" ] && [ $AR_HAS_COMMIT == "0" ]; then
39
39
40
40
mv -f " dist/esp32-arduino-libs.zip" " dist/$LIBS_ZIP_FILENAME "
41
41
LIBS_ASSET_ID=` github_release_asset_upload " $AR_LIBS_REPO " " $LIBS_RELEASE_ID " " $LIBS_ZIP_FILENAME " " dist/$LIBS_ZIP_FILENAME " `
42
- echo " LIBS_ASSET_ID: $LIBS_ASSET_ID "
43
42
if [ -z " $LIBS_ASSET_ID " ]; then
44
43
echo " ERROR: Failed to upload asset '$LIBS_ZIP_FILENAME '"
45
44
exit 1
@@ -51,6 +50,8 @@ if [ $LIBS_HAS_ASSET == "0" ] && [ $AR_HAS_COMMIT == "0" ]; then
51
50
local_size=$( stat -c%s " dist/$LIBS_ZIP_FILENAME " )
52
51
IDF_LIBS_DL_URL=" https://github.com/$AR_LIBS_REPO /releases/download/$LIBS_RELEASE_TAG /$LIBS_ZIP_FILENAME "
53
52
53
+ echo " Downloading asset '$LIBS_ZIP_FILENAME ' and checking integrity..."
54
+
54
55
# Download the file
55
56
remote_file=" remote-$LIBS_ZIP_FILENAME "
56
57
curl -s -L -o " $remote_file " " $IDF_LIBS_DL_URL "
@@ -96,18 +97,18 @@ if [ $LIBS_HAS_ASSET == "0" ] && [ $AR_HAS_COMMIT == "0" ]; then
96
97
fi
97
98
98
99
# Clean up the downloaded file
99
- rm " $filename "
100
+ rm " $remote_file "
100
101
101
102
# Print the results
102
103
echo " Tool: esp32-arduino-libs"
103
104
echo " Version: $LIBS_VERSION "
104
105
echo " URL: $IDF_LIBS_DL_URL "
105
106
echo " File: $LIBS_ZIP_FILENAME "
106
- echo " Size: $size bytes"
107
- echo " SHA-256: $sha256sum "
107
+ echo " Size: $local_size bytes"
108
+ echo " SHA-256: $local_checksum "
108
109
echo " JSON: $AR_OUT /package_esp32_index.template.json"
109
110
cd " $AR_ROOT "
110
- python3 tools/add_sdk_json.py -j " $AR_OUT /package_esp32_index.template.json" -n " esp32-arduino-libs" -v " $LIBS_VERSION " -u " $IDF_LIBS_DL_URL " -f " $LIBS_ZIP_FILENAME " -s " $size " -c " $remote_checksum "
111
+ python3 tools/add_sdk_json.py -j " $AR_OUT /package_esp32_index.template.json" -n " esp32-arduino-libs" -v " $LIBS_VERSION " -u " $IDF_LIBS_DL_URL " -f " $LIBS_ZIP_FILENAME " -s " $local_size " -c " $local_checksum "
111
112
if [ $? -ne 0 ]; then exit 1; fi
112
113
113
114
if [ ` github_release_asset_upload " $AR_LIBS_REPO " " $LIBS_RELEASE_ID " " $LIBS_JSON_FILENAME " " $AR_OUT /package_esp32_index.template.json" ` == " " ]; then
0 commit comments